One of the key advantages of online school programs is the flexibility they offer to students. With online classes, students have the opportunity to create their own schedules and learn at their own pace. This flexibility is especially beneficial for students who are juggling work, family responsibilities, or extracurricular activities. online school programs also allow students to access their courses from anywhere with an internet connection, eliminating the need for long commutes and providing greater accessibility to education.
Another benefit of online school programs is the variety of courses and programs available to students. Online schools offer a wide range of courses, including advanced placement classes, career and technical education programs, and even college-level courses. This allows students to tailor their education to their interests and goals, and explore subjects that may not be available at their local schools. Additionally, online school programs often provide opportunities for students to earn industry certifications and college credits while still in high school, giving them a head start on their future careers.
online school programs also provide a unique learning environment that can cater to the needs of individual students. In online classes, students have the opportunity to work independently and collaborate with their peers in virtual discussions and group projects. This fosters a sense of independence and self-motivation in students, as they take ownership of their learning and develop important communication and teamwork skills. Additionally, online school programs often offer personalized support and resources to help students succeed, such as online tutoring, academic advising, and career counseling.
Despite the many benefits of online school programs, there are also challenges that students and educators may face. One common challenge is the lack of face-to-face interaction in online classes, which can make it difficult for students to build relationships with their teachers and classmates. This can lead to feelings of isolation and loneliness, especially for students who thrive in a social learning environment. To address this challenge, many online school programs incorporate virtual classroom sessions, discussion boards, and group projects to encourage communication and collaboration among students.
Another challenge of online school programs is the need for students to be self-disciplined and motivated in order to succeed. Without the structure of a traditional school day, students may struggle to stay organized and manage their time effectively. Procrastination and distractions from home can also impact students’ ability to focus and complete their assignments. To overcome these challenges, online school programs often provide students with time management tools, study tips, and support services to help them stay on track and reach their academic goals.
